With the MLB trade deadline just two days away, the Boston Red Sox are considering a trade for Blue Jays All-Star George Springer. Currently sitting at 50-59, the Blue Jays are expected to be sellers, making Springer available. The 36-year-old, whose contract is expiring, could fulfill a pressing need for the Red Sox. Reports suggest that a potential trade involving Red Sox player Jarren Duran could not only benefit both teams but also align with Springer's interest in joining Boston. His past performance at Fenway Park shows promise for an impactful transition.
